S/RVs 3.4.3 SURVEILLANCE REQUIREMENTS SURVEILLANCE Verify the safety function lift setpoints of the required S/RVs are as follows:
NOTE ------------------------
Up to two inoperable required S/RVs may be replaced with spare OPERABLE S/RVs having lower setpoints until the next refueling outage.
Number of S/RVs 2
6 8
Setpoint (psig) 1175 (Ž1140 and < 1210) 1195 (> 1160 and < 1230) 1205 (> 1169 and < 1241)
Following testing, lift settings shall be within +1%.
FREQUENCY In accordance with the Inservice Testing Program Amendment 151, 175 SUSQUEHANNA - UNIT 2 SR 3.4.3.1 i
